WWE NXT Talent Missed Months Of TV Due To 'Freak Accident'

'Freak accident' leads to injury for WWE NXT talent

While they are no longer injured, Fightful Select's Corey Brennan has reported that Eddy Thorpe missed months of TV due to a hip injury that he suffered in a "freak accident." 

Thorpe hasn't appeared on WWE NXT TV on Tuesday nights since December 2023 when he defeated Dijak in their NXT Underground Match. There was no announcement in the weeks following the match that Thorpe was dealing with an injury. Following the "freak accident", Thorpe was not cleared to return to the ring until late February or early March. 

Thorpe has yet to resurface on NXT TV despite being cleared to return but Fightful noted that Thorpe is expected to return to the Tuesday night show in the near future. Thorpe has been utilised on NXT Level Up and at NXT house shows during his time off NXT TV proper. 

Thorpe suffered from injuries in 2023, including sustaining an unknown injury in October of last year. He then worked hurt leading into NXT Deadline, a show which saw him return to cost Dijak the Iron Survivor Challenge. 

Eddy Thorpe has been a part of WWE since signing with the company in January 2023. He was previously a part of New Japan Pro-Wrestling for four years but he exited the promotion in the Summer of 2022 when his contract expired.
